We don't have any Mac machine here. We paid for "Hosted Builder", why still need enter ip?
We assumed the "compile & run" is start from the "Hosted Builder" and we have some way to get back the project.ipa file. Is that right?
You need to enter the iPhone / iPad IP address not the address of the Mac computer.
The IDE will connect to the iPhone and will allow you to install the app and to debug it. You can also download the ipa file after you compile from the build server menu.

Yes the Windows computer must be able to connect to the hosted builder over the internet and to connect to the iPhone directly over the local network. The iPhone also needs an internet connection to download the ipa file from the hosted builder.
